From e9967fa22781d922ba4eb8fb44fe72d200ac4b14 Mon Sep 17 00:00:00 2001
From: Jake Vanderwerf <get@jakevanderwerf.ca>
Date: Mon, 10 Nov 2025 21:04:10 +0000
Subject: [PATCH] =IconsManager.php update

---
 inc/helpers/members.php |    8 ++++----
 1 files changed, 4 insertions(+), 4 deletions(-)

diff --git a/inc/helpers/members.php b/inc/helpers/members.php
index 007210e..e4d8386 100644
--- a/inc/helpers/members.php
+++ b/inc/helpers/members.php
@@ -208,13 +208,13 @@
             return 'admin';
         }
     }
-    $user = ($ID === 0) ? wp_get_current_user() : get_userdata($ID);
-
-	if (user_can($user, 'manage_options')) {
+	if ($ID > 0 && user_can($ID, 'manage_options')) {
 		return 'admin';
 	}
+    $user = ($ID === 0) ? wp_get_current_user() : get_userdata($ID);
+	error_log('Current User: '.print_r($user, true));
     return array_values(array_intersect(
-        array_keys(JVB_USER),
+        array_keys(array_merge(JVB_USER, ['administrator'])),
         array_map(function ($role) {
             return jvbNoBase($role);
         },

--
Gitblit v1.10.0